Parameter: Networks
Default: An empty list
Options: A list of network identifiers. Each entry consists of a network number, a
mask, and a flag to indicate whether the ID refers to a specific network or
a range of networks.
Function: Specifies the networks to which this policy applies.
Instructions: Enter a specific encoding of 0.0.0.0/0.0.0.0 to match the default route.
Enter a range encoding of 0.0.0.0/0.0.0.0 to match any route. Use the
default empty list to match any route.
MIB Object ID: RIP: 1.3.6.1.4.1.18.3.5.3.2.6.1.1.5
OSPF: 1.3.6.1.4.1.18.3.5.3.2.6.3.1.5
EGP: 1.3.6.1.4.1.18.3.5.3.2.6.5.1.5
BGP-3: 1.3.6.1.4.1.18.3.5.3.2.6.7.1.5
BGP-4: 1.3.6.1.4.1.18.3.5.3.2.6.9.1.5
Parameter: Action
Default: RIP, OSPF, EGP: Accept
BGP-3, BGP-4: Ignore
Options: Accept
|
Ignore
Function: Specifies whether the protocol ignores a route that matches the policy or
forwards the route to the routing table manager.
Instructions: Specify Accept to consider the route for insertion in the routing table. To
drop the route, specify Ignore.
MIB Object ID: RIP: 1.3.6.1.4.1.18.3.5.3.2.6.1.1.6
OSPF: 1.3.6.1.4.1.18.3.5.3.2.6.3.1.6
EGP: 1.3.6.1.4.1.18.3.5.3.2.6.5.1.6
BGP-3: 1.3.6.1.4.1.18.3.5.3.2.6.7.1.6
BGP-4: 1.3.6.1.4.1.18.3.5.3.2.6.9.1.6
